ICICI Prudential Life Insurance has introduced a new market-linked product, ICICI Pru Smart Insurance Plan Plus, designed to help customers build wealth over the long term. This product is affordable, with a monthly premium of just ₹1000, making it accessible to a large cross-section of young customers. The product combines a life cover component, which ensures that the customer’s family is financially secure, with a systematic investment plan to achieve long-term financial goals.

According to Amit Palta, Chief Product and Distribution Officer at ICICI Prudential Life Insurance, the product is specifically designed to encourage young people to start investing early and remain invested for the long term. India’s growth story is driven by its youth, who make up about 65% of the population, and ULIPs (Unit Linked Insurance Plans) like ICICI Pru Smart Insurance Plan Plus are effective wealth creation tools.

The product offers a range of features, including 25 funds and four portfolio strategies to choose from, allowing customers to fine-tune their asset allocation without incurring any costs or tax implications. Additionally, customers can opt for the Waiver of Premium add-on benefit, which ensures that their long-term savings goal remains on track even if the policyholder is unable to pay premiums.

The product is available for purchase through a complete digital journey, catering to the preferences of the target segment.
